What is a Remote IP Relay Operator?

A Remote IP Relay Operator is a professional who facilitates communication between individuals with hearing or speech disabilities and standard telephone users. They do this by relaying typed messages from the person using an internet-based relay service to the hearing person over the phone, and then typing back the spoken response. This role is typically performed remotely, allowing operators to work from home or other locations with internet access. The job requires excellent typing, listening, and communication skills, as well as sensitivity to confidentiality and user need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ote IP relay operator?

To thrive as a Remote IP Relay Operator, you need excellent typing skills, strong command of the English language,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with telecommunications systems, relay service platforms, and secure internet applications is typically required. Outstanding attention to detail, active listening, and the ability to maintain confidentiality help set candidates apart in this role. These skills ensure accurate and efficient message relay between callers, supporting effective and private communication for individuals who are deaf or hard of hearing.

What are some common challenges faced by remote IP relay operators and how can they be managed effectively?

Remote IP Relay Operators often encounter challenges such as maintaining focus during repetitive tasks, managing high call volumes, and ensuring accurate message relay between parties. Working from home can also present distractions, so creating a dedicated, quiet workspace is essential. Operators can manage these challenges by taking regular short breaks, using ergonomic equipment, and staying organized with digital tools. Effective communication skills and strict adherence to confidentiality protocols are also crucial for success in this role.
